With three locations across Tennessee: Lynchburg, Thompson’s Station, and Townsend, Company Distilling has become a cornerstone of Tennessee’s craft spirits movement. Founded by Master Distiller Jeff Arnett (former Jack Daniel’s Master Distiller and 2017 Master Distiller of the Year) and Kris Tatum, we bring decades of Tennessee distilling expertise to every bottle we produce.
What makes Company Distilling truly unique is our innovative approach to finishing our multi-award-winning bourbon whiskeys. Each of our flagship whiskeys is finished with a native Tennessee hardwood for a taste that’s truly one-of-a-kind—a technique that honors the state’s rich natural heritage while creating distinctive flavor profiles you won’t find anywhere else.
Our Straight Bourbon Whiskey Finished with Maple Wood is where tradition meets innovation. This complex and smooth wheated bourbon blends three different wheated mash bills from three different states—two column distilled and one pot distilled—for incredible depth. Aged between 3 years 10 months and 6 years, this 90-proof bourbon enters with sweet notes of caramel and cinnamon toast paired with green apple, then finishes with a silky blend of oak and maple. The maple wood finishing adds a subtle sweetness and warmth that perfectly complements the wheated mash bill.
Our Straight Tennessee Whiskey Finished with Apple Wood (formerly Tennessee Three Wood) celebrates Tennessee’s whiskey-making heritage through the Lincoln County Process. Mellowed through maple charcoal, matured in charred white oak, and finished with toasted apple wood, this expression showcases the diversity of Tennessee’s fruit and hardwood trees. At 86.5 proof, it opens with aromas of cinnamon, nutmeg, and golden raisins, then delivers a subtle blend of sweet vanilla, cinnamon, cloves, and plums with a soft warm oak finish.

And we’d be remiss not to mention our award-winning Ghost Rail Tennessee Dry Gin. Distilled on an open-fired alembic still using just six botanicals including locally foraged ingredients, Ghost Rail delivers a bright and clean flavor profile—citrus-forward without being sharp, with a prominent juniper note that defines its character, and herbal without overwhelming the palate. It’s equally stunning in a classic martini or a refreshing gin and tonic, proving that a Tennessee whiskey distiller can craft world-class gin too.

3. Chattanooga Whiskey (Chattanooga) – Experimental Excellence
About 60 miles south of our Townsend location, these innovators in Chattanooga revived the city’s 100-year prohibition on distilling and released their first whiskey, marking a historic milestone as the first whiskey produced in Chattanooga since Prohibition. They have since become one of the most innovative producers in the state. Their Experimental Batch series releases limited runs that explore different grains, yeast strains, and barrel treatments, each offering a distinctive nose that highlights unique aromatic profiles.
The Experimental Batch 033 Triple Peat Blended Whiskey layers three different peated malts for a Tennessee whiskey with Scottish influence—smoky, complex, and utterly unique. Their core Chattanooga Whiskey 111 (formerly “1816 Reserve”) offers a high-rye bourbon mash that delivers spice, fruit, and oak in perfect harmony.
What makes Chattanooga Whiskey essential for small batch spirits TN enthusiasts is their transparency. Each experimental batch comes with detailed information about the production process, allowing drinkers to understand exactly what makes each bottle special. The state’s craft distillers benefit from Tennessee’s limestone-filtered water (the same natural advantage that made Tennessee whiskey famous), a climate that accelerates barrel aging, and access to quality grains from local farmers. These natural advantages, combined with passionate distillers willing to experiment, have created a spirits scene that rivals anywhere in the country.
